svscanboot(8)                                       svscanboot(8)


NAME
       svscanboot  -  starts svscan(8) in the /service directory,
       with output and error messages logged through  readprocti-
       tle(8).

       svscanboot is available in daemontools 0.75 and above.

SYNOPSIS
       svscanboot

DESCRIPTION
       svscanboot runs the pipeline

       svscan /service 2>&1 | readproctitle service errors: .....

       with 400 dots. The last 400 bytes of error  messages  from
       svscan(8)  will  be  visible  to ps(1) through readprocti-
       tle(8).

       svscanboot sets $PATH to

        /command:/usr/local/bin:/usr/local/sbin:
        /bin:/sbin:/usr/bin:/usr/sbin:/usr/X11R6/bin

       (all in one line, no space)

       and clears all other environment variables. Program  writ-
       ers  are  encouraged  to  use  globally allocated names in
       /command.
